Exploring Future Careers at Lot Fourteen!
Our Year 9 and 10 students recently visited Lot Fourteen to explore emerging technologies and discover the exciting career pathways developing right here in South Australia.
Students visited the Australian Space Agency, explored the world of cybersecurity, and learned how artificial intelligence (AI) is being developed and used across a range of industries. They had the opportunity to see the work and research happening within these organisations and discover how they could build a future career in these rapidly growing fields.
